When a permit is required
Permit triggers and exempt work for Amherst
A Town zoning certificate is required for most major construction projects or changes in the use of land, including building additions, new houses, signs, sheds, and operating a business from a residence. After Town zoning approval, a building permit from Amherst County is also required for regulated construction work.

- Building code
- Construction must conform with the Virginia Uniform Statewide Building Code. Amherst County administers the 2021 Virginia Construction Code (VCC), 2021 Virginia Residential Code (VRC), 2021 Virginia Statewide Fire Prevention Code (VSFP), and 2020 NEC, effective January 18, 2024.
- Permit validity
- The Town zoning certificate expires 365 days after approval.
- Owner-builder
- No separate Town owner-builder rule applies. Building-permit owner-builder issues are handled through Amherst County Building Safety and Inspections and Virginia contractor-licensing law.
- Contractor requirements
- The Town does not license contractors separately for building-code purposes. Building permits are issued by Amherst County. State contractor licensing is regulated by the Virginia DPOR Board for Contractors. A separate Town business license may be required for business activity in Town.

Application process
Typical processing: Administrative zoning certificates: no standard review time posted. Applications requiring public hearings: several weeks due to notice requirements and hearing schedule. Board of Zoning Appeals matters: Virginia Code requires action within 90 days of receipt of the application.
- 01 Confirm the project is inside the corporate limits of the Town of Amherst. If yes, begin with Town zoning review before applying to Amherst County for the building permit.
- 02 For most major construction or changes in land use (building additions, new houses, signs, sheds, operating a business from a residence), obtain a Town zoning certificate.
- 03 For routine administrative zoning approvals, submit the zoning certificate application to the Town Manager, who serves as Zoning Administrator. Most such requests are handled administratively and no fee is charged.
- 04 If the proposal requires Planning Commission, Town Council, or Board of Zoning Appeals action, submit a cover letter, signed application, site plan or other appropriate drawings, and the required fee to the Town Manager.
- 05 For rezonings and special use permits, the Town Manager reports the application to the Planning Commission at its next regular meeting, followed by a public hearing. The Planning Commission forwards a recommendation to Town Council, which then schedules its own public hearing.
- 06 For variances and appeals, the application goes to the Board of Zoning Appeals chair for scheduling of the required public hearing.
- 07 Once all Town zoning issues are resolved and the zoning permit or approval is issued, proceed to Amherst County Building Safety and Inspections at 153 Washington St, Amherst, VA 24521 (phone: 434-946-9302) to apply for the building permit, land-disturbance permit, and any other required county permits.

Required inspections
Scheduling and sequence
- Amherst County Building Safety and Inspections: 434-946-9302 (phone)
- Scheduling deadline
- Call Amherst County Building Inspections by 5:00 p.m. the day before the requested inspection. Sprinkler-system inspections require 48 hours notice.
- Inspection hours
- Town Hall hours: Monday-Friday, 9:00 a.m. to 5:00 p.m. Building inspections are conducted by Amherst County (8:30 a.m. to 5:00 p.m.).
Typical sequence: Building inspections are performed by Amherst County Building Safety and Inspections, not the Town. Town zoning review precedes the county building permit step; there is no separate Town building inspection sequence.
